Vehicle Data - 2010 General Dynamics M1163 ITV-PM 4x4 Growler
Mileage 334 Miles
VIN PM034

MWM Sprint 4 Cylinder Turbo Diesel Engine, Automatic Transmission, 4x4, Central Tire Inflation System, Air Ride Suspension, Terrain Mobilizer, Dual Fuel Tanks, Front Winch, 2 Door, 3 Passenger, Soft Top, 235/85R16 Tires, 5,776 lb. GVW

KWIZ87 wrote:
July 1st, 2019, 9:16 am
Didn't General Dynamics get a hold of some A2s and make some bodys in the early 2000's
Nobody has made M-151 bodies other than the aftermarket since production ended somewhere in the late eighties I believe it was. The aftermarket bodies were made on real frames and were welded, not unibody construction. Pretty sure Encore was the last of them in 2000.
